If you have been following along with me on Instagram this past summer, you just may have noticed that I have a new passion in my life- hiking. The spark was actually lit last fall when my son & I took a little road trip to Harpers Ferry, West Virginia to photograph the fall foliage. As we were walking around snapping pics, my son noticed a sign for the Maryland Heights Trail that takes you across the Potomac River and up to a cliff with breathtaking views of Harpers Ferry and the valleys below. He mentioned how awesome it would be if he & I did that hike together if only to capture the views from the top. So we started making plans, and in June of this summer we made the 4 mile round trip trek to Overlook Cliff. 

Being my first hike in years (like in almost 2 decades), I would be lying if I said it wasn't physically challenging. But despite the sore muscles I had the next day (and the day after that), the chance to connect with nature, to spend one-on-one time with my son, and the scenery I was rewarded with when I reached the top got me hooked. A few days after our June hike, we were already planning our next one...
